**Vendor note: Inkmill markdown pipeline**

Rendering for Parchway docs is outsourced to Inkmill under an annual contract, renewing each March. They handle sanitization and PDF export; we own the upload queue. SLA: 4-hour response on rendering failures. Escalate only after two failed retries. Their support desk is reachable at the address below.

billing contact of hahaf-baguf = zorael.tammir.jorius@sivrelhq.internal

Break-glass: FormulaPen sandbox. If the sandbox that evaluates user-supplied formulas wedges and the normal admin path is down, you can break glass — but heads up, this gets logged and Orla will ask questions. Grab the sealed console on the Tarnwick jump host, start bg-shell, and when it challenges you, type the recovery passphrase printed just below.

vault phrase of bagaf-kajeg = jorath-feniel-briir-siliel-ralix

Ticket: Waveform preview in Chordline's upload screen renders flat for files over ~10 min — looks like we downsample to zero. Future maintainers: the peak computation lives in `wavekit/peaks.ts` and silently clamps long buffers. Fix the chunk stride, add a regression clip. Repro builds should cite the identifier printed below.

trace token, fafog-kageg: htk4_98e6

- [ ] Shared component library (Thistle UI): verify semantic versioning is enforced on every release, that breaking changes ship only in majors, and that the changelog is updated alongside each tag. As a new contractor, do not publish versions yourself; all release approvals go through the library steward named below.

named custodian: Quenael Briax